When all else fails on Quantico here in the next 3 weeks, just follow these rules and you will at least have a fighting chance.

1) Got on a topo map sight and look for aerial images...find thick green pine bedding areas, preferably on tops of hills

2) Try to find those bedding areas that are at least 500 yards from the road

3) Set up downwind of those bedding areas, maybe 30 yards off
